When Is the Weather Best in Bradford?

The best weather in Bradford typically occurs during late spring (May) and summer (June-August). Temperatures during these months are generally milder, with average highs ranging from approximately 15°C to 21°C (59°F to 70°F). While rain is a possibility year-round in the UK, these months offer the highest chance of sunshine and longer daylight hours, ideal for exploring outdoor attractions.

What Are the General Recommendations for Visiting Bradford?

Bradford’s weather can be unpredictable, so packing layers is always recommended, regardless of the season. Bring waterproof outerwear and comfortable walking shoes. Consider your primary interests – whether it’s exploring museums, attending festivals, or enjoying scenic walks – to align with the best time for your specific activities.
